The Daytona Beach Police Department (DBPD) is investigating a traffic accident between a car and a motorcycle where the motorcyclist involved passed away at the scene from injuries sustained in the accident.
Officers responded to the intersection of Caroline Street & U.S. 92/West International Speedway Boulevard around 5:30 p.m. today (March 28, 2022), soon after Volusia County emergency dispatchers received a call for help.
Members of DBPD’s Traffic Homicide Unit arrived shortly afterward to process the scene for evidence and speak to witnesses.
Preliminary investigation shows that a white 2015 Chevrolet Malibu driven by a 24-year-old Daytona Beach woman was heading north on Caroline when the vehicle entered the eastbound travel lanes of ISB. A black 2021 Kawasaki motorcycle heading east on ISB entered the intersection at the same time.
The front of the Kawasaki collided with the front driver’s side of the Chevrolet, leading to the motorcyclist – a 35-year-old Daytona Beach man – being thrown off the motorcycle. He landed on the road near the impact point and was pronounced dead by paramedics shortly after they arrived on scene.
The driver of the Chevrolet moved her vehicle from the intersection after the accident happened and stopped on Keech Street, where she waited for police to arrive. She has been cooperating with investigators.
Both vehicles have been towed from the scene and will be processed further for evidence as part of this active and ongoing investigation.
An autopsy will be performed to determine if drugs or alcohol were a factor in this accident.
Charges are pending the completion of the investigation.
